What is OSXPMem FOR MAC?

OSXPMem


OSXPMem is a free memory imager that helps you grab physical memory on Intel-based Macs. Pretty neat, right?


What Does OSXPMem Do?


This tool has two main parts. First, there’s osxpmem, which takes care of looking at the accessible bits of physical memory. Then, we have the kernel extension called pmem.kext. This part gives you read-only access to that physical memory.
